Fuel System Checks

- Determine if the condition is rich or lean by operating the vehicle under the conditions of the concern while monitoring the oxygen sensor output.
- Check for leaking fuel injectors.
- Check for fuel in the fuel pressure regulator vacuum hose, if equipped. This indicates a faulty gasoline fuel pressure regulator.
- Check for proper operation of the CNG fuel injectors. See FUEL INJECTOR COIL TEST , FUEL INJECTOR BALANCE TEST WITH SPECIAL TOOL and FUEL INJECTOR BALANCE TEST WITH TECH 2 under FUEL SYSTEMS (CNG) in SYSTEM & COMPONENT TESTS - 2.2L ALERO, CAVALIER, GRAND AM & SUNFIRE article.
- Check for proper EVAP Purge system operation.
- Check for proper alternative fuel system pressures. See FUEL SYSTEM DIAGNOSIS (CNG) under FUEL SYSTEMS in BASIC DIAGNOSTIC PROCEDURES - 2.2L ALERO, CAVALIER, GRAND AM & SUNFIRE article.
